Postfixben és infixben?

Tartalomjegyzék:

Postfixben és infixben?
Postfixben és infixben?
Anonim

Infix kifejezés egy olyan kifejezés, amelyben az operátor az operandusok közepén van, mint az operandus operátor operandus. A postfix kifejezés olyan kifejezés, amelyben az operátor az operandusok után van, mint például az operandus operátor. A postfix kifejezéseket a rendszer könnyen kiszámítja, de ember által nem olvashatók.

Mi az infix és postfix az adatstruktúrában?

Vegyük fontolóra az A + B infix kifejezést. … Az előtag kifejezés jelölése megköveteli, hogy minden operátor megelőzze azt a két operandust, amelyen dolgozik. Ezzel szemben a Postfix megköveteli, hogy operátorai a megfelelő operandusok után következzenek.

Hogyan szerezhetek postfixet az infixből?

A Postfix Infixké konvertálásának lépései:

  1. Olvassa be a szimbólumot a bemenetről. …
  2. Ha a szimbólum operandus, akkor tolja be a verembe.
  3. Ha a szimbólum operátor, akkor a verem felső 2 értéke előugrik.
  4. ez a 2 előugró érték a mi operandusunk.
  5. hozzon létre egy új karakterláncot, és tegye az operátort az operandus közé a stringbe.
  6. told be ezt a karakterláncot a verembe.

Mi az utótag és előtag?

Előtag: Egy kifejezést prefix kifejezésnek nevezünk, ha az operátor az operandusok előtt szerepel a kifejezésben. … Utótag: Egy kifejezést postfix kifejezésnek nevezünk, ha a operátor a kifejezésben a operandusok után jelenik meg. Egyszerűen a formából (operand1 operandus2 operátor).

Miért jobb a postfix, mint az infix?

A Postfixnek van egy számaaz infixhez képest az algebrai képletek kifejezésének előnyei. Először is, bármely képlet kifejezhető zárójel nélkül. Másodszor, nagyon kényelmes a képletek kiértékeléséhez veremekkel rendelkező számítógépeken. Harmadszor, az infix operátorok elsőbbséget élveznek.